Transaction 6cda6582073c7ebf757e4c2d521bbc5a496c436b90e1b396368e1b32e6506fde
1 Input
2 Outputs
- 6cda6582073c7ebf757e4c2d521bbc5a496c436b90e1b396368e1b32e6506fde:0
- 6cda6582073c7ebf757e4c2d521bbc5a496c436b90e1b396368e1b32e6506fde:1
value 775946
address 3MGKYRsWGxCs6Ysvvyy8hcVcTA6DrwMevo
value 16889710
address 31mheTkocLa7omdAymHkCrVEHdW4B7xEzD